Virat Kohli-led Team India started 2020 on a perfect note by dismantling Sri Lanka by wickets in the second T20I at Indore’s Holkar Stadium. With the first match abandoned without a ball being bowled, India also took an unassailable lead in the three-match series with an impressive seven-wicket win.

Virat Kohli’s decision to bowl first was totally justified by his bowlers as India restricted Sri Lanka to 142 for 9. The Islanders started well with their openers Danushka Gunathilaka and Avishka Fernando adding 38 runs for the first wicket in less than five overs.

But after the powerplay, Sri Lanka’s innings never got the impetus as they kept losing wickets at regular intervals. In an attempt to up the scoring rate, their batsmen played some rash shots and thus they eventually ended on 142 for 9. Kusal Perera was the top-scorer for his side, scoring 34 while Shardul Thakur was the pick of the bowlers with 3 for 23.

In reply, India chased down the total inside 18 overs and with seven wickets in hand. In-form KL Rahul and Shikhar Dhawan laid the foundation for the easy chase by adding 71 runs for the first wicket before the former departed for 45. Dhawan departed soon too after scoring 32 before Virat Kohli and Shreyas Iyer added 51 runs to all but seal the win.

Speaking after the game, Virat Kohli expressed his delight over the performance. He pointed out the performance of the bowlers especially Navdeep Saini as he said that the team has gone from strength to strength.

“Very happy. It was a clinical performance. We have gone from strength to strength. It’s a very good sign for the team. Navdeep has come into the ODI circuit as well, he gaining more confidence. You can really seem letting himself go. It’s great to see getting him take wickets with yorkers and bouncers.

“Good to see Burmah back too. I think one guy will be surprise package going to Australia. Kuldeep takes the ball away so does Washington. As a captain, you need more than five bowlers. Beautiful surface, we bowled beautifully well. As a bowler, no one like bowling here. You want to see guys stepping up,” he added.
